In focus: The flood-climate catastrophe of 1342 - Reese & Ërnst tell the forgotten local historyReese tells Ërnst about "The Margarethen Flood 1342", a forgotten climate catastrophe in which over 500 people died due to 40 days of continuous rain. The rivers overflowed their banks in central Germany, entire areas of the country were covered by floods, and rural areas experienced extreme hardship. The population even had to resort to unusual foods such as donkeys to survive hunger.
